Evolution of Streams through Urban and
Rural Landscapes (Field Biology, Chemistry, Environmental Toxicology)
Researchers in this team are Investigating stream
evolution through changing landscapes by assessing stream hydrology,
ecology, geochemical cycling and biotic interactions.

Molecular Diagnostics and
high-Throughput Technologies (Molecular Biology, Biochemistry,
Toxicology)
Researchers in this team are working to develop
real-world rapid, sensitive and inexpensive molecular detection
platforms for detection of food pathogens and applying molecular
forensics to the environment.

Nanotoxicology (Physiology,
Neurobiology, Analytical Chemistry, Environmental Toxicology)
Researchers in this team are investigating the health
effects of
nanoparticles in animals and the environment.
If you work on this project you
will learn to use
confocal and
fluorescence microscopy, how to measure heavy
metals in tissue and water samples using world class analytical
instruments like inductively
coupled plasma mass spectroscopy,
HPLC,
and animal exposure and dissection techniques.

Metabolite Identification
(Biochemistry, Analytical Chemistry, Botany, Molecular Biology)
Researchers in this team are working on chemical
profiling of medicinal plant and effects of stress on plant physiology.
